This international gathering of leading Shakespeare scholars is held every two years, in the summer.
It was initiated at Mason Croft in the 1940s under the auspices of the British Council, and has been hosted by The Shakespeare Institute since its establishment in 1951. About 230 members meet to hear papers and participate in seminars on a chosen theme.
Membership of the Conference is by invitation only.
